Sainz: My only target is to be a Red Bull driver

< > Carlos Sainz has made it clear that he is not terribly enthused by the prospect of spending another year as a Toro Rosso driver, but his team bosses have nipped his ambitions by stating that he will drive next year where they tell him to drive. It took a game of tennis between the young Spaniard and Red Bull F1 boss Christian Horner, umpired by Helmut Marko, for both parties to return to the same page. Sainz told the F1 website, 'I have my opinion and I said it in that very moment. Maybe I could have used a different wording to put it. It is not something that I enjoyed, seeing Helmut Marko and Christian Horner going against me, but it sometimes happens in a Formula 1 career. But...
